Route Briefing: Amsterdam to Costa Rica

There's a moment somewhere over the Atlantic, maybe your third hour into this 13-and-a-half-hour journey from Amsterdam, when you start mentally rehearsing what awaits you — howler monkeys at dawn, volcanic steam rising through cloud forest, waves peeling perfectly along a black-sand Pacific beach. That anticipation is entirely justified, because Costa Rica genuinely delivers on its reputation in a way few destinations do.

KLM, United Airlines, and Copa Airlines all serve this route year-round, and the connection points matter more than you might think. Routing through Houston or Panama City tends to unlock the most competitive fares, so when you're searching, filter specifically for those hubs. A roundtrip under $600 is a genuinely good deal on this route — standard fares push past $900 — and booking two to four months ahead gives you the best shot at landing in that sweet spot. It's the kind of price difference that funds an extra night at a lodge near Arenal or a guided wildlife tour in Tortuguero.

You'll land at Juan Santamaría International Airport, which sits just outside San José. Shared shuttle services and taxis are readily available from the terminal, and many travelers find that booking a shuttle in advance to their first destination — whether that's the capital itself or heading directly toward the coast or highlands — saves both time and hassle after a long travel day.

Timing your visit shapes the entire experience. December through January and July through August are peak seasons, bringing more crowds and higher accommodation prices but also reliable dry weather in many regions. The so-called green season, roughly May through November outside those peak months, brings lush landscapes, fewer tourists, and lower costs — though you should expect afternoon rain showers, particularly in the rainforest zones.

What makes Costa Rica so rewarding is the sheer density of experiences packed into a small country. You can soak in volcanic hot springs near Arenal, spot sloths and toucans in Manuel Antonio, surf world-class breaks along the Nicoya Peninsula, and walk suspension bridges through cloud forest canopy — sometimes all within the same week. The national philosophy of "Pura Vida" isn't just a marketing slogan; it genuinely reflects the relaxed, welcoming pace of life you'll encounter everywhere.

One tip worth taking seriously: resist the urge to over-schedule. Costa Rica rewards slowness. Build in buffer days, leave room for spontaneous detours, and you'll come home with stories that no itinerary could have planned.
